Yes. Checkers parking stops are designed for straightforward installation on asphalt and concrete surfaces. Their flexible construction allows them to conform to uneven pavement.
For asphalt, 1/2 inch rebar spikes are driven through the mounting holes into pre-drilled holes approximately 3 to 4 inches deep. For concrete, 1/2 inch or 5/8 inch lag bolts with plastic shields are used. Pilot holes are drilled, shields are inserted to the required depth, and the parking stop is secured with lag bolts.
Installation requires standard tools such as a heavy duty drill with a masonry bit and basic anchoring hardware. Once installed, parking stops require minimal maintenance, with periodic inspection and tightening of anchors as needed. Rubber, plastic, and concrete parking stops are essential for organizing parking areas, preventing vehicle damage, and protecting pedestrians and infrastructure. Concrete stops are the traditional choice, valued for their weight and stability, but they are very heavy and can crack, chip, or deteriorate from freeze-thaw cycles or impact over time—often requiring frequent maintenance and repainting. In contrast, rubber and plastic parking stops are much lighter, making installation and repositioning fast and easy for a single person without heavy equipment. They are also low-maintenance, highly weather-resistant, and far less likely to chip or crack, providing better long-term value—especially in climates with temperature extremes or high precipitation.
